**Question 9:** Consider the equation \(d = 3 - \frac{1}{12}t\) where \(d\) represents your distance from home for each minute, \(t\), that you walk. **What does the slope mean in this context?** A. The distance you walk every minute B. The distance you are from home when you start walking C. The total distance you walk D. The total time you walk Option A is circled as the chosen answer, with a large "X" marked next to it, and a note below saying “choose one.” *Explanation:* In this context, the equation \(d = 3 - \frac{1}{12}t\) represents a linear relationship where the slope \(-\frac{1}{12}\) indicates the rate of change in distance per minute. This means that each minute, the distance from home decreases by \(\frac{1}{12}\), which matches option A: "The distance you walk every minute."
